COMPARISON OF FATIGUE PARAMETERS OF ALKALI-ACTIVATED AND ORDINARY PORTLAND CEMENT BASED CONCRETES
Seitl Stanislav, Bílek Vlastimil, Keršner Zbynek
Abstract: Concretes used in civil structures are usually made on ordinary Portland cement (OPC) base. Alkali activated concretes (AAC) are considered as a perspective building materials. They show high strength, good durability, and good resistance to aggressive agents etc. This paper introduces the values of the basic fatigue parameters of both types of concrete; the alkali-activated concrete is prepared as a new material for the potential production of concrete elements developed by ZPSV, a.s. company. The concrete mixtures have a similar utilization and therefore the fatigue parameters can be compared. The specimens were prepared and tested under static (compressive strength) and cyclic loading (fatigue parameters Wöhler curve). The experimentally obtained results (mechanical and fatigue) of both types of concrete are compared and the suitability of these types of composites for their application is discussed.
Keywords: Fatigue, Wöhler curve, Fracture mechanics, Alkali-Activated Concrete, concrete C45/55
